身安不如心安,屋宽不如心宽 。

es修改文档时"script"里面的\"1\"格式可以改成某种把\去掉的格式吗

Elasticsearch | 作者 sueisok | 发布于2017年03月30日 | 阅读数:4816

-XPOST _update_by_query
{.........
    "query"{
        ........
    },
    "script"{
        "inline":"ctx._source.num"=\"1\""
    }
}
其中,num是int型,\"\"这个里面也可以放string的
同事说有转义字符貌似不好使,让我把\这样的去掉,我查了半天不懂能怎么改
哪位大佬懂脚本啊啊求助(づ ̄ 3 ̄)づ
 
已邀请:

medcl - 今晚打老虎。

赞同来自:

\"1\" 直接改成1不就完了么?
程序里面是不是可以在外面parse成int再拼string

要回复问题请先登录注册